In humans, genetic variations are caused because humans reproduce by a sexual life cycle which is termed as meiosis. In such a life cycle, the offspring receives half the chromosomes from the mother and half from the father. Crossing over and random assortment of chromosomes are two phenomenons which occur during meiosis. Due to these two phenomenons, genetic variations are caused.
During crossing over, the exchange of DNA segments between the homologous chromosomes takes place which brings about the genetic variations.
Biodiversity is essential to an ecosystem's resistance against viruses and famine. In history, there has been many cases in which a lack of biodiversity has allowed a virus or disease to endemically wipe out an entire species of plant. This will subsequently affect all consumers of each trophic level. Ex: A disease that attacks the DNA of only one certain species of plant would cause decreases in the population of the organisms that rely on eating that plant, the organisms that rely on eating those organisms, and so on. This is caused by a decrease in food source, thus not being able to sustain the ecosystem's demand, thus naturally killing off any organisms that would not be able to find a sufficient food source.

The word acidification can be misleading because a pH of 7.9 is still considered slightly alkaline. However, as the graphs in these three locations show, as CO2 rises, the pH drops, moving in the direction of the acidic end of the pH scale.
